    Bavaria NV: Ambush marketing Bavaria NV is an independent Dutch brewery (owned by the Swinkles family) which operates in 120 countries‚ it is the second largest brewery in Holland producing over 5 million litres of beer annually. The Bavaria brand name originated in 1924. when the Swinkels brothers decided to change from the change from the common top-fermenting to bottom-fermenting beer: pilsner.     Who We Are: The Leukemia and Lymphoma Society is the leading non-profit organization for blood cancer information‚ resources‚ and patient support. The organization became established in 1949 by Rudolph and Antoinette de Villiers in honor of their son who was diagnosed with the disease. LLS mission is to find a cure for blood cancer and provide their patients with the best medical care and resources available.
